Hi everyone,
I'm trying to deploy a haystack RAG pipeline to EBS or EC2 on one of the lower config machines (2CPU - 2GB RAM and 2CPU 4GB RAM). While building the container, I used pip install 'farm-haystack[inference]' ## installs torch, sentence-transformers, sentencepiece, and huggingface-hub.
I was wondering, since I only intend to do inference on the CPU, why does it have to install torch and other heavier libraries. Is there a lighter install?
Otherwise, is there a cheaper deployment pipeline for a RAG solution?
